Smart Climate Sensors
Smart climate sensing units have transformed the effectiveness of modern watering systems by readjusting watering schedules based on real-time environmental data. These sensing units check variables such as temperature level, humidity, wind speed, and solar radiation, allowing systems to respond dynamically to altering weather. By integrating this information, wise sensors can optimize water usage, reducing waste and making certain that landscapes obtain the appropriate quantity of moisture. This modern technology not just preserves water yet additionally advertises much healthier plant development by stopping overwatering or underwatering. Additionally, the automation supplied by smart weather condition sensors enhances individual convenience, as landscaping companies and homeowners can depend on specific watering timetables without hands-on treatment. Generally, these innovations represent a substantial innovation in sustainable irrigation practices.

Soil Dampness Sensors
Soil dampness sensors play an important duty in contemporary irrigation systems, offering real-time data that boosts water performance. These tools gauge the volumetric water content in the dirt, enabling specific evaluations of moisture degrees. By incorporating soil dampness sensors into irrigation systems, users can stay clear of overwatering or underwatering, ultimately advertising healthier plant development and preserving water resources.The sensors transfer information to controllers, which can change sprinkling timetables based on existing dirt problems. This data-driven technique minimizes water waste and assurances that plants receive the most effective amount of wetness. Additionally, soil wetness sensing units can be valuable in numerous agricultural settings, from home yards to large ranches. The release of these sensors adds to lasting techniques by supporting accountable water use and minimizing environmental impact. On the whole, the incorporation of soil dampness sensing units marks a significant innovation in accomplishing effective view website watering systems.

What Is the Lifespan of Modern Lawn Sprinkler Elements?
The life-span of modern-day automatic sprinkler components commonly varies from 5 to twenty years, depending on the products used, upkeep methods, and environmental problems. Routine upkeep can significantly enhance resilience and efficiency gradually.
